Currently, it is widely perceived among the English as a Foreign Language (EFL) teaching professionals, that motivation is a central factor for success in language learning. This work aims to examine and raise teachers’ awareness about the role of assessment and feedback in the process of language teaching and learning at polytechnic school in Benguela to develop and/or enhance their students’ motivation for learning. Hence the paper defines and discusses the key terms and, the techniques and strategies for an effective feedback provision in the context under study. It also collects data through the use of interview and questionnaire methods, and suggests the assessment and feedback types to be implemented at polytechnic school in Benguela

A violência doméstica em Angola – mormente em Benguela não é um problema novo. Mas nos últimos dez anos, este fenómeno muda de figura, pois, toma um carácter cada vez mais perturbador já que frequentemente resulta em mutilações e não raras vezes em vítimas mortais. Assim, este trabalho de investigação procura esclarecer as causas, os factores sobretudo, os de ordem sociocultural que estejam na base do incremento da violência doméstica no seio familiar nestes últimos anos. Deste modo, este trabalho consiste numa análise sociocultural do problema da violência doméstica em Benguela. E os resultados alcançados nesta investigação revelam que, os factores que estão na base desta alteração comportamental dos elementos da família são: a desagregação da família tradicional, desestruturação socioeconómica das famílias, a desorientação cultural e axiológica - deturpação da escala de valores. Estes factores constituem a consequência do conflito armado que o país viveu durante cerca de três décadas. Por outro lado, emergem outros factores resultantes da dinâmica social como, a modernização da vida social, a emancipação da mulher - sua promoção social e profissional - a influência dos meios de comunicação social e o intercâmbio cultural com vários povos de outras culturas, e ainda outros, como os desajustes de carácter educacional que afecta o pensar e o carácter das novas gerações. Estes factores não são um registo habitual da história deste povo, mas foram favorecidos pelas vicissitudes do tempo. Na verdade, o conflito armado foi o principal responsável na destruição dos valores que serviam de base a boa convivência dos elementos das famílias angolanas. Pois, deturpou a escala de valores, deixou sequelas de vária ordem o que resulta em frustrações que frequentemente desorientam a reflexão crítica perante os problemas quotidianos, criando assim comportamentos violentos. Desta feita, esta investigação com os conhecimentos que traz á luz, constitui uma contribuição para o ponto de partida para a tomada de medidas por quem é de direito para lutar contra este flagelo, que é na realidade um mal social.

Nitrogen fixation data from the cruise number MSM18/5 with research vessel "Maria S. Merian" from 22.08.-20.09.2011 (from Walvis Bay to Walvis Bay) in front of Angola and northern Namibia. Samples taken by CTD- rosette sampler from different depths and incubated in glass bottles (535 ml) at light intensities that resemble the in situ light intensities of the sampling depth after 15N2 gas was injected to the sample. After the incubation time of 6 hours, the complete bottle content was filtered onto a pre-combusted Whatman GF/F filter. Filters were frozen, transported to the institute on dry ice and measured in a mass spectrometer for Delta 15N. The principle of the method was described by Montoya et al. (1996) and calculation was done according to their spread sheet. From the data of the single depths, the nitrogen fixation per square meter within the upper 40 m of the water column was calculated. The methods are described in detail in a paper submitted by Wasmund et al. in 2014 to be printed in 2015. Some results are surprisingly below zero. This occurs if the Delta 15N of the blank is higher than the measurement after incubation. It indicates that no nitrogen fixation occurred. Due to natural variability, the variability of the nitrogen fixation data is high. In an overall estimate, also over several cruises, negative and positive values compensate more or less, suggesting that nitrogen fixation is insignificant in the waters in front of northern Namibia and southern Angola.

A família é o meio natural em que a criança começa sua vida e sua aprendizagem básica por meio de uma série de estímulos e de vivências que a condicionam profundamente ao longo de toda a sua existência. A escola representa o espaço em que a criança consolida a sua aprendizagem e se prepara para vida futura. A cooperação entre família e escola constitui o pilar fundamental na construção de um processo de ensino aprendizagem de qualidade, sobre tudo para crianças com Necessidades Educativas Especiais (N.E.E). Com base nestes pressupostos o objetivo geral da presente dissertação de natureza qualitativa é aferir o impato do envolvimento familiar no processo de ensino aprendizagem dos alunos com necessidades educativas especiais na cidade de BenguelaAngola, através de inquéritos e entrevistas aplicadas a uma amostra constituída pelos familiares dos alunos, os respetivos alunos, professores e antigos gestores da única escola de Ensino Especial da cidade de Benguela. Os resultados do estudo revelaram um fraco grau de envolvimento familiar, tendo em conta as orientações da Lei, nº 13/01, Lei de Bases do Sistema de Educação (L.B.S.E), e o Decreto Presidencial nº 20/11, sobre o Estatuto da Modalidade de Educação Especial que recomendam a participação indispensável da família na elaboração dos programas (E.M.E.E) educativos dos alunos com N.E.E, bem como os resultados de estudos que ressaltam a importância da relação escola e família para melhoria da qualidade do Ensino Especial em Angola. A dissertação constitui uma abordagem pioneira no contexto em que se insere e o seu valor prático é determinado pelo contributo que os seus resultados podem aportar a compreensão e melhoria da qualidade de ensino e das relações familiares dos alunos com N.E.E num contexto fortemente marcado por barreiras culturais e tradicionais.

Processes of enrichment, concentration and retention are thought to be important for the successful recruitment of small pelagic fish in upwelling areas, but are difficult to measure. In this study, a novel approach is used to examine the role of spatio-temporal oceanographic variability on recruitment success of the Northern Benguela sardine Sardinops sagax. This approach applies a neural network pattern recognition technique, called a self-organising map (SOM), to a seven-year time series of satellite-derived sea level data. The Northern Benguela is characterised by quasi-perennial upwelling of cold, nutrient-rich water and is influenced by intrusions of warm, nutrient-poor Angola Current water from the north. In this paper, these processes are categorised in terms of their influence on recruitment success through the key ocean triad mechanisms of enrichment, concentration and retention. Moderate upwelling is seen as favourable for recruitment, whereas strong upwelling, weak upwelling and Angola Current intrusion appear detrimental to recruitment success. The SOM was used to identify characteristic patterns from sea level difference data and these were interpreted with the aid of sea surface temperature data. We found that the major oceanographic processes of upwelling and Angola Current intrusion dominated these patterns, allowing them to be partitioned into those representing recruitment favourable conditions and those representing adverse conditions for recruitment. A marginally significant relationship was found between the index of sardine recruitment and the frequency of recruitment favourable conditions (r super(2) = 0.61, p = 0.068, n = 6). Because larvae are vulnerable to environmental influences for a period of at least 50 days after spawning, the SOM was then used to identify windows of persistent favourable conditions lasting longer than 50 days, termed recruitment favourable periods (RFPs). The occurrence of RFPs was compared with back-calculated spawning dates for each cohort. Finally, a comparison of RFPs with the time of spawning and the index of recruitment showed that in years where there were 50 or more days of favourable conditions following spawning, good recruitment followed (Mann-Whitney U-test: p = 0.064, n = 6). These results show the value of the SOM technique for describing spatio-temporal variability in oceanographic processes. Variability in these processes appears to be an important factor influencing recruitment in the Northern Benguela sardine, although the available data time series is currently too short to be conclusive. Nonetheless, the analysis of satellite data, using a neural network pattern-recognition approach, provides a useful framework for investigating fisheries recruitment problems.

Hoje, nenhuma língua está livre de influências de outra língua; fruto da facilidade com que os homens interagem. Uma das consequências desta interacção reside na influência da língua de uns sobre a de outros, o que geralmente ocorre com interferência da língua materna (LM) do indivíduo na sua segunda língua (LS). Para abordar este fenómeno realizámos em Benguela um estudo que consistiu no levantamento e análise de algumas expressões activas no dia-a-dia dos Benguelenses para detectar elementos de interferência do Umbundu no Português, como resultado da coabitação das duas línguas e desta forma contribuir para estudos linguísticos que visem esclarecer os processos inerentes a coabitação entre linguas africanas e europeias. Para o efeito, levamos a cabo uma análise das expressões inventariadas para melhor compreender as razões que concorrem para ocorrência de tais interferências, as quais se converteram num dos principias elementos na caracterização do português falado naquela região de Angola. Assim, na nossa condição de docentes, se torna absolutamente necessário identificar estes fenómenos, já que eles constituem parte integrante da nossa tarefa quotidiana de orientação das aprendizagens em Português.

A feature of Pliocene climate is the occurrence of "permanent El Niño-like" or "El Padre" conditions in the Pacific Ocean. From the analysis of sediment cores in the modern northern Benguela upwelling, we show that the mean oceanographic state off Southwest Africa during the warm Pliocene epoch was also analogous to that of a persistent Benguela "El Niño". At present these events occur when massive southward flows of warm and nutrient-poor waters extend along the coasts of Angola and Namibia, with dramatic effects on regional marine ecosystems and rainfall. We propose that the persistent warmth across the Pliocene in the Benguela upwelling ended synchronously with the narrowing of the Indonesian seaway, and the early intensification of the Northern Hemisphere Glaciations around 3.0-3.5 Ma. The emergence of obliquity-related cycles in the Benguela sea surface temperatures (SST) after 3 Ma highlights the development of strengthened links to high latitude orbital forcing. The subsequent evolution of the Benguela upwelling system was characterized by the progressive intensification of the meridional SST gradients, and the emergence of the 100 ky cycle, until the modern mean conditions were set at the end of the Mid Pleistocene transition, around 0.6 Ma. These findings support the notion that the interplay of changes in the depth of the global thermocline, atmospheric circulation and tectonics preconditioned the climate system for the end of the warm Pliocene epoch and the subsequent intensification of the ice ages.
